现在A页面有一个visual web part, 是一个gridview,记录一些信息,每行最后一列有一个超链接,点击之后可以跳转到另一个页面,显示另一个web part。
A页面:
编号 姓名
1 我 详细
2 你 详细
3 他 详细
点击“详细”链接之后,跳转至另一个页面
B页面:
编号 姓名 性别 年龄
1 我 男 10
我的需求就是在A页面点击“详细”之后,把编号传到B页面,然后在B页面做一下数据库检索把这个编号所有信息显示在B页面。
请问如何用web part在不同也页面上传值?
------解决方案--------------------
我提供一个方案,就是A页面跳转到B页面的时候,在URL上带上参数,然后在B页面page load的时候,读取参数,就可以实现传值了。
------解决方案--------------------
我们是2个方法。
1,session
2,公共方法
------解决方案--------------------
赞同一楼的方案,通过URL传递参数。SharePoint中使用Session的话还需要启用Session功能。启用Session还需要做一些配置和修改 才能启用Session。